TY - CONF A1 - Glocker, Kevin A1 - Georges, Munir T1 - Hierarchical Multi-Task Transformers for Crosslingual Low Resource Phoneme Recognition BT - Proceedings of the 5th International Conference on Natural Language and Speech Processing (ICNLSP 2022) N2 - This paper proposes a method for multilingual phoneme recognition in unseen, low resource languages. We propose a novel hierarchical multi-task classifier built on a hybrid convolution-transformer acoustic architecture where articulatory attribute and phoneme classifiers are optimized jointly. The model was evaluated on a subset of 24 languages from the Mozilla Common Voice corpus. We found that when using regular multi-task learning, negative transfer effects occurred between attribute and phoneme classifiers. They were reduced by the hierarchical architecture. When evaluating zero-shot crosslingual transfer on a data set with 95 languages, our hierarchical multi-task classifier achieves an absolute PER improvement of 2.78% compared to a phoneme-only baseline.
